30-days learning plan to master web development, covering H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and foundational concepts 👇👇

### Week 1: HTML and CSS Basics
Day 1-2: HTML Fundamentals
- Learn the structure of HTML documents.
- Tags: <!DOCTYPE html>, <html>, <head>, <body>, <title>, <h1> to <h6>, <p>, <a>, <img>, <div>, <span>, <ul>, <ol>, <li>, <table>, <form>.
- Practice by creating a simple webpage.

Day 3-4: CSS Basics
- Introduction to CSS: Selectors, properties, values.
- Inline, internal, and external CSS.
- Basic styling: colors, fonts, text alignment, borders, margins, padding.
- Create a basic styled webpage.

Day 5-6: CSS Layouts
- Box model.
- Display properties: block, inline-block, inline, none.
- Positioning: static, relative, absolute, fixed, sticky.
- Flexbox basics.

Day 7: Project
- Create a simple multi-page website using HTML and CSS.

### Week 2: Advanced CSS and Responsive Design
Day 8-9: Advanced CSS
- CSS Grid.
- Advanced selectors: attribute selectors, pseudo-classes, pseudo-elements.
- CSS variables.

Day 10-11: Responsive Design
- Media queries.
- Responsive units: em, rem, vh, vw.
- Mobile-first design principles.

Day 12-13: CSS Frameworks
- Introduction to frameworks (Bootstrap, Tailwind CSS).
- Basic usage of Bootstrap.

Day 14: Project
- Build a responsive website using Bootstrap or Tailwind CSS.

### Week 3: JavaScript Basics
Day 15-16: JavaScript Fundamentals
- Syntax, data types, variables, operators.
- Control structures: if-else, switch, loops (for, while).
- Functions and scope.

Day 17-18: DOM Manipulation
- Selecting elements (getElementById, querySelector).
- Modifying elements (text, styles, attributes).
- Event listeners.

Day 19-20: Working with Data
- Arrays and objects.
- Array methods: push, pop, shift, unshift, map, filter, reduce.
- Basic JSON handling.

Day 21: Project
- Create a dynamic webpage with JavaScript (e.g., a simple to-do list).

### Week 4: Advanced JavaScript and Final Project
Day 22-23: Advanced JavaScript
- ES6+ features: let/const, arrow functions, template literals, destructuring.
- Promises and async/await.
- Fetch API for AJAX requests.

Day 24-25: JavaScript Frameworks/Libraries
- Introduction to React (components, state, props).
- Basic React project setup.

Day 26-27: Version Control with Git
- Basic Git commands: init, clone, add, commit, push, pull.
- Branching and merging.

Day 28-29: Deployment
- Introduction to web hosting.
- Deploy a website using GitHub Pages, Netlify, or Vercel.

Day 30: Final Project
- Combine everything learned to build a comprehensive web application.
- Include H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and possibly a JavaScript framework like React.
- Deploy the final project.

### Additional Resources
- HTML/CSS: MDN Web Docs, W3Schools.
- JavaScript: MDN Web Docs, Eloquent JavaScript.
- Frameworks/Libraries: Official documentation for Bootstrap, Tailwind CSS, React.
- Version Control: Pro Git book.

Practice consistently, build projects, and refer to official documentation and online resources for deeper understanding.
